The third week they began using aerobic exercise classes and took their pulses to discover the relationship of exercise to their heart. A chef came in and gave them samples of healthy foods. The class also prepared and ate their own vegetable soup.

For Dental Week a dentist visited their class to demonstrate correct care of teeth.

At the end of the month the students compiled their own book with all their own writings and drawings and information they had learned (little did they know they were learning while having alot of fun).
